Every business can benefit from receiving appropriate and timely legal advice. However, each business’s need for legal counsel varies, and it may not be significant enough to warrant the cost of hiring and maintaining in-house counsel. For this reason, Southern Atlantic Law Group provides outside general counseling services that will satisfy your legal needs while operating within the constraints of your budget. 

Though some people may contact different attorneys on a case-by-case basis, they are missing out on a valuable component of having a single source for outside counsel. Southern Atlantic Law Group devotes time and resources to learning about the client and their unique business objectives. When clients approach us, they deserve advice that speaks to their goals while operating within the legal landscape of their specific industry. 

Retaining Southern Atlantic Law Group as outside general counsel gives the business access to an attorney who will become familiar with the business’s industry and operations at a fraction of the cost of a full-time in-house attorney.   We are also available to handle corporate legal matters on a project-by-project basis.
